Latest web development tutorials

Métodos DOM HTML

El método es una acción que podemos realizar en el nodo (elementos de HTML).


Interfaz de programación

Por JavaScript (y otros lenguajes de programación) el acceso a HTML DOM.

Todos los elementos HTML se definen como un objeto, y la interfaz de programación es el método de objeto y las propiedades del objeto.

El método es una operación (por ejemplo, agregar o modificar elementos) que puede realizar.

La propiedad es que se puede obtener o valor establecido (por ejemplo, nombre de nodo o contenido).


getElemenById método ()

getElemenById () devuelve el elemento con el ID especificado:

Ejemplos

var element=document.getElementById("intro");

Trate »


HTML objetos DOM - métodos y propiedades

Algunos métodos DOM HTML de uso común:

  • getElemenById (id) - Obtener nodo (elemento) con el id especificado
  • appendChild (nodo) - insertar un nuevo nodo secundario (elemento)
  • removeChild (nodo) - Elimina el nodo hijo (elemento)

Algunos comúnmente usados ​​HTML DOM atributos:

  • innerHTML - nodo (elemento) valor de texto
  • parentNode - nodos (elementos) del nodo padre
  • childNodes - nodo (elemento) del nodo hijo
  • atributos - nodo (elemento) nodo de atributo

En este tutorial vamos a aprender más acerca de la siguiente propiedad de los capítulos.


objetos de la vida real

Una persona es un objeto.

Un enfoque podría ser comer (), sleep (), el trabajo (), play (), y así sucesivamente.

Todos estos métodos tienen, pero van a ser ejecutados en diferentes momentos.

La propiedad de una persona, incluyendo su nombre, altura, peso, edad, sexo y así sucesivamente.

Todo el mundo tiene estas propiedades, pero sus valores varían.


Algunos métodos de objeto DOM

Aquí están algunos métodos comunes que ha aprendido en este tutorial para:

camino descripción
getElemenById () Devuelve el elemento con el ID especificado.
getElementsByTagName () Devuelve una lista de nodos (matriz de conjuntos / nodo) que contiene todos los elementos con el nombre de la etiqueta especificada.
getElementsByClassName () Devuelve una lista de todos los elementos con el nodo especificado contiene el nombre de la clase.
appendChild () Para añadir un nuevo nodo secundario al nodo especificado.
removeChild () Elimina el nodo secundario.
replaceChild () Vuelva a colocar los nodos secundarios.
insertBefore () Insertar un nuevo nodo secundario frente al nodo secundario especificado.
createAttribute () Crear nodo de atributo.
createElement () Crear un nodo elemento.
createTextNode () Crear un nodo de texto.
getAttribute () Devuelve los valores de los atributos especificados.
setAttribute () Para establecer o modificar el valor especificado de la propiedad especificada.